
New York Early Onion
Allium cepa
Life cycle: annual
Yellow onion that produces round, medium to large onions. Medium length storage.
Growing conditions: Onions like fertile, well-drained and loose soil. Plant in full sun and water regularly, aiming for about 1” of water per week.
Sowing instructions: Sow in trays 6-8 weeks before last frost date, either in 128 cells with 1 seed per cell or in 72 cells with 3-4 seeds per cell. Transplant 4-6 inches apart in rows 12-18 inches apart.
